The Corporate Bookmaking Team is seeking a Managing Editorial Assistant to support the Penguin Workshop Managing Editorial team. The ideal candidate will have a passion for children's books, be detail-oriented, eager to collaborate across departments, and adaptable to a fast-paced, high-volume, creative environment.
Penguin Workshop publishes a range of children's books, including New York Times bestsellers, beloved characters, and licensed properties, in formats such as picture books, middle grade, young adult, and graphic novels.
This position is remote and offers a salary of $51,000, with eligibility for annual bonuses based on company performance. Applications are due by June 20th via our online process, including your resume, cover letter, and salary expectations.
